Chiaming Yen's Cyber Universe

  • Home
    • SMap
    • reveal
    • blog
  • About
    • KMOL
    • MDE
    • ToDo
    • Google
      • Blogger
      • Youtube
  • Python
  • Portable
    • Lua 解譯
    • Wink
      • Add Wink
  • CMSiMDE
    • 建立網頁
    • 基本操作
      • 客製化
      • 編輯網頁內容
      • 上傳與引用檔案
      • 上傳與引用圖片
      • 嵌入程式碼
      • 嵌入影片檔
      • 檢視 STL
    • 置入 disqus
    • Gitlab 同步
    • Heroku 部署
    • Fossil SCM
    • 注意事項
      • 標題選擇
      • 靜態網頁 404
      • 動態網站錯誤
    • 延伸開發
    • 已知問題
      • IPv6
      • 上傳資料引用
      • MathJax
      • html 分頁
      • 靜態搜尋
      • template
      • 重複標題頁面
    • ajax
    • black
    • summernote
建立網頁 << Previous Next >> 客製化

基本操作

當使用者利用 cms.bat 啟用動態網站後, 即可利用瀏覽器 https://localhost:9443 (系統啟動之 IP 與埠號可以在 init.py 中設定), 在近端維護網站內容, 由於此時動態網站僅在 localhost 啟動, 因此可以使用內建的管理者密碼 "admin" 登入管理網站內容, 若是使用外部 IP 啟動, 則必須自行修改管理者密碼.

在 Windows 操作系統, cms.bat 內容為:

python cmsimde/wsgi.py

若是在 Mac 或 Linux 操作系統, 則 cms 為可執行檔, 且內容為:

#! /bin/bash
python3 cmsimde/wsgi.py

至於 acp.bat 在 Windows 操作系統的內容為:

echo off
set message=%1
git add .
git commit -m %message%
git push

但是在 Mac 與 Linux 操作系統, 則 acp 為可執行檔, 而內容則為:

#! /bin/bash
git add .
git commit -m "$1"
git push

在 Windows 執行 batch 檔案, 可以直接在命令列視窗執行 cms 或 acp "提交訊息", 但是在 Mac 與 Linux 執行 Bash 檔案, 必須使用 ./cms 或 ./acp "提交訊息".

假如使用者修改 init.py 中的 ip 或 uwsgi 設定, 讓動態網站在外部 IP 啟動, 則必須自行透過動態網站中的 config 指令修改管理者密碼.

動態網站編輯表單中的 config 除了可更改網站管理者密碼外, 也可以更改網站的頁面內容標題 (外部標題可以透過 init.py 中的 site_title 更改).


建立網頁 << Previous Next >> 客製化

Copyright © All rights reserved | This template is made with by Colorlib